Migraine Treatment

This treatment is for those who suffer from chronic migraines. With the use of neuromodulators (Botox, Dysport, Xeomin), this treatment helps relieve symptoms of migraines. Consultation must be done prior to appointment but can be done at the same time of appointment. Prescriptions accepted.

Teeth Grinding

TMJ/ Bruxism also referred to as teeth grinding is a quick appointment to help alleviate the discomfort in the face, jaw-joint area, neck and shoulders. This is done by targeting the master muscle with neuromodulators. (ie. Botox). The amount needed to get desired results depends on the strength of the individuals muscles. Prescriptions accepted. 

Excessive Sweating

Hyperhidrosis also known as excessive sweating is a medical condition when the body sweats more than average. This treatment reduces sweating in the underarm sweat glands with neuromodulator (ie. botox) injections.
